• 제목/요약/키워드: aviation software

검색결과 113건 처리시간 0.037초

DO-178C 기반 체크리스트를 활용한 무인동력비행장치 소프트웨어 인증 방안 (LUAV Software Certification Method using Checklists based on DO-178C)

  • 권지훈;이동민;박경민;이은희;임석훈;최용훈;나종화
    • 항공우주시스템공학회지
    • /
    • 제17권1호
    • /
    • pp.33-41
    • /
    • 2023
  • 보잉 737 맥스 사고사례에서 볼 수 있듯이 항공기 소프트웨어는 비중이 급속도로 증가하고 있으나 안전문제에서 취약한 것이 드러났다. 국내의 경우, 자체중량 150kg 이하 무인동력비행장치를 운용하려면 초경량비행장치 안전성인증이 요구되지만, 소프트웨어 인증 절차는 포함되지 않는다. 다만, 최근 무인동력비행장치의 활용이 증대됨에 따라 소프트웨어 검증이 요구되는 추세이다. 본 논문은 항공 소프트웨어 인증 규격인 DO-178C를 참조하여 무인동력비행장치에 적용할 수 있는 무인동력비행장치 소프트웨어 체크리스트를 제안하였다. 국내외 선진기업 및 기관에서 활용 중인 모델기반개발(Model-based Development) 기반의 헬리콥터 비행 제어 컴퓨터(FCC) 프로젝트에 제안된 체크리스트를 적용하는 사례연구를 수행하였다.

HAUSAT-2 비행소프트웨어 개발 (FLIGHT SOFTWARE DEVELOPMENT FOR HAUSAT-2 ON-BOARD COMPUTER)

  • 심창환;류정환;최영훈;장영근
    • 한국우주과학회:학술대회논문집(한국우주과학회보)
    • /
    • 한국우주과학회 2006년도 한국우주과학회보 제15권1호
    • /
    • pp.117-120
    • /
    • 2006
  • HAUSAT-2 비행소프트웨어 개발은 HAUSAT-2의 요구 조건을 분석하였고, 분석 결과에 따라서 HAUSAT-2 비행소프트웨어를 설계하였다. 설계 완료 후 소프트웨어 코딩 및 컴파일을 수행하고, 개별 시험과 통합 시험을 거쳐 비행소프트웨어의 알고리즘을 검증한다. 현재 HAUSAT-2의 개발 상황은 시험 모델에 대한 통합 시험을 마쳤고, 시험 결과를 분석하여 비행소프트웨어의 수정 및 운영 체제 추가 개발을 진행 중에 있다. 본 논문에서는 HAUSAT-2 비행소프트웨어(flight software)의 아키텍처와 전반적인 개발 과정 그리고 개발 환경에 대하여 설명한다.

  • PDF

증강현실 및 가상현실 기술의 항공 인증 제안 (Air Certificcation Proposal of Augmented Reality and Virtual Reality Technology)

  • 최정호
    • 한국융합학회논문지
    • /
    • 제12권11호
    • /
    • pp.285-289
    • /
    • 2021
  • 본 논문에서는 항공소프트웨어 인증 규정 발전 동향을 파악하고, 증강현실 및 가상현실 소프트웨어의 항공정비 산업 적용을 위해 항공에 최적화된 인증 규정을 소개한다. 이 규정은 항공정비 산업에 적용된 증강현실 및 가상현실 소프트웨어에 엄격한 인증 규정을 적용함으로써 항공정비 산업에 적용된 증강현실 및 가상현실 소프트웨어의 안정성과 신뢰성을 제공할 것으로 기대된다. 기존에 사용되는 DO-178B, DO-178C가 규정하기 힘든 문제들을 고려한 인증 규정을 제시하고자 한다.

DGPS 기준국 신호분석 소프트웨어 (Signal Analysis Software for DGPS Station)

  • 황호연
    • 한국항공운항학회지
    • /
    • 제15권2호
    • /
    • pp.1-8
    • /
    • 2007
  • In this research, algorithm and software for the medium frequency signal analysis of DGPS(Differential Global Positioning System) station were developed. Based on new MF(Medium Frequency) algorithm, the software of NDGPS(National DGPS) signal analysis was developed for coverage analysis. Predicted MF propagation data from this software was compared to the measurement data for the verification of a developed MF algorithm. GIS(Geographic Information System) techniques including digital map with elevation data were used because MF propagation is closely related to ground conductivity, mountains, building intensity.

  • PDF

Ad hoc Software Rejuvenation for Survivability

  • Khin Mi Mi Aung;Park, Jong-Sou
    • 한국정보보호학회:학술대회논문집
    • /
    • 한국정보보호학회 2003년도 동계학술대회
    • /
    • pp.141-145
    • /
    • 2003
  • We propose the model of Software Rejuvenation methodology, which is applicable for survivability. Software rejuvenation is a proactive fault management technique and being used in fault tolerant systems as a cost effective technique for dealing with software faults. Survivability focuses on delivery of essential services and preservation of essential assets, even systems are penetrated and compromised. Thus, our objective is to detect the intrusions in a real time and survive in face of such attacks. As we deterrent against an attack in a system level, the Intrusion tolerance could be maximized at the target environment. We address the optimal time to execute ad hoc software rejuvenation and we compute it by using the semi Markov process. This is one way that could be really frustrated and deterred the attacks, as the attacker can't make their progress. This Software Rejuvenation method can be very effective under the assumption of unknown attacks. In this paper, we compute the optimum time to perform an ad hoc Software Rejuvenation through intrusions.

  • PDF

항공안전을 강화하기 위한 소프트웨어 안전성 법제도 방안 (The Legal System Method of Software Safety to Strengthen Aviation Safety)

  • 지정은;이상지;신용태
    • 한국항행학회논문지
    • /
    • 제15권5호
    • /
    • pp.687-695
    • /
    • 2011
  • 지식 정보 기술력 중심의 지식기반 경제 원천인 소프트웨어로 인한 결함은 항공기의 운용에 핵심 역할을 수행하는 엔진에 영향을 준다. 따라서 소프트웨어의 안전성분석을 통해 항공안전을 강화하여 결함으로부터의 위험을 최소화해야 한다. 본 논문에서는 항공기 결함과 소프트웨어 안전성 법 제도를 살펴보고 항공안전을 강화하기 위한 법 제도 개선 및 제정 방안을 제안한다. 안전성분석과 관련된 용어 정립, 안전성이 포함된 품질인증 기준, 안전성분석서를 첨부해야 하는 품질인증 신청, 평가 및 인증기관 세부지침 개정 등의 항목으로 기존 법 제도를 개선해야 한다. 또한, 소프트웨어 평가 및 인증 의무화, 소프트웨어 생명주기에 다른 지속적 평가, 표준화된 개발방법론 도입 의무화, 고급인력 양성 제도 강화 등의 항목으로 신규 법 제도를 제정해야한다. 소프트웨어 안전성과 관련된 기존 법 제도를 개선하고 신규 법 제도를 제정하여 소프트웨어의 품질 향상과 강화된 항공안전을 기대할 수 있다.

상용 기성품 기반 항공기 임무컴퓨터 구현에 관한 연구 (A Study on Implementation of a Mission Computer based on COTS)

  • 양성욱;양준모;이상철
    • 한국항공운항학회지
    • /
    • 제22권4호
    • /
    • pp.81-86
    • /
    • 2014
  • In the development of an avionics system, there is a trend of using commercial-off-the-shelf(COTS) equipments in order to reduce the development cost and time. In this paper, we present an implementation of an aircraft mission computer using the objected oriented software and the COTS equipments. We execute the aircraft guidance software on the system, and measure the calculation time and the used memory. To compare the guidance capability of the software program, we implement the same software logic on DS1104 system. The guidance software program executed on two different systems resulted in the almost identical simulation.

항공용 소프트웨어 안전성 및 개발시 주의사항에 대한 고찰 (A Study on Safety of Airborne Software and Considerations during Development)

  • 이백준;최종연;남기욱
    • 한국항공운항학회지
    • /
    • 제24권2호
    • /
    • pp.81-85
    • /
    • 2016
  • It is recognized that safety is a key point of technical competency. Its adoption is widely spread in development of products and it is essentially necessary in aerospace industry because airborne system and equipment are used complex high-technology and implemented systematic performance using software. This study reviews system safety assessment, development assurance level, airborne software, RTCA DO-178 process, and considerations & pitfalls in software development.

항공전자 시스템 개발에 관한 연구 (A Study on the Development of an Avionics System)

  • 양성욱;이상철
    • 한국항공운항학회지
    • /
    • 제15권1호
    • /
    • pp.61-67
    • /
    • 2007
  • The importance and cost of avionics system in the integration of an aircraft is continuously increasing. And we can expect enlarged software portion in the system integration for the more intelligent, reliable, and automated avionics system. Both military and commercial avionics community have moved toward commercial-off-the-shelf(COTS) equipment and open systems architecture not only to increase affordability but also to reduce acquisition cost, shorten development time and risk. The same concept is applied in developing avionics test system used for the avionics system integration test. In this paper, we present important topics in the development of avionics system including real-time operating system, interconnect data bus, software development methodology, software development process, and system integration test.

  • PDF